Control effect of cumin essential oils on three stored-product insects

  • The stored-product insects were vital factor for safety of grain storage. Sitophilus zeamais, Rhizopertha dominica, Cryptolestes pusillus were treated with cumin essential oils ( CEO) , which were extracted by water distillation method. The toxicity of repellency, fumigant and contact of CEO against three stored-product adult insects were tested as well as LC50 and LT50 of fumigant toxicity were determined.The result indicated that the control effects of CEO against three kinds of insects were different.C.pusillus was more susceptible on repellency and fumigant than other two insects, however, R. dominica showed the most susceptible on contact toxicity.
